Analytical Overview of LED Lights for Harley-Davidson

The aftermarket for Harley-Davidson lighting has seen a significant shift towards LED technology, driven by advancements in bulb efficiency, durability, and light output. Consumers are increasingly seeking brighter, whiter light to improve visibility, enhance safety, and customize the distinctive aesthetic of their motorcycles. This trend is further fueled by the declining cost of LED components and a growing awareness of their longevity compared to traditional halogen bulbs, which often require replacement every few thousand miles. The demand for integrated lighting solutions, such as full headlight assemblies with built-in LED technology, is also on the rise, offering a cleaner look and simplified installation.

One of the primary benefits of upgrading to LED lights for Harley-Davidson motorcycles is a dramatic improvement in nighttime and low-visibility riding conditions. LEDs produce a much brighter and more focused beam of light, allowing riders to see further down the road and identify potential hazards earlier. Studies have shown that LED headlights can increase visibility distances by up to 50% compared to their halogen counterparts. Beyond safety, LEDs consume significantly less power, which can reduce the strain on the motorcycle’s electrical system, especially beneficial for bikes with limited charging capacity. This lower power draw also translates to a longer lifespan; while a halogen bulb might last 500 to 1,000 hours, LEDs can often last 30,000 to 50,000 hours, meaning they may never need replacement during the ownership of the motorcycle.

However, the transition to LED lighting isn’t without its challenges. While the technology is mature, some riders still encounter issues with heat management in certain LED headlight designs, which can affect performance and lifespan if not properly engineered. Furthermore, the legality of aftermarket LED headlights can be a gray area in some regions, with strict regulations on beam patterns and light intensity to prevent blinding oncoming traffic. This means that selecting the best LED lights for Harley Davidson requires careful consideration of compliance with local road laws. The initial cost of high-quality LED kits can also be a barrier for some riders, although the long-term savings in bulb replacement and potential for reduced electrical load often offset this upfront investment.

Despite these hurdles, the advantages of LED lighting for Harley-Davidson motorcycles are compelling and continue to drive adoption. The combination of enhanced safety, reduced maintenance, improved aesthetics, and lower energy consumption makes LEDs a highly desirable upgrade. As manufacturers continue to innovate, focusing on improved heat dissipation, more refined beam patterns, and integrated CAN-bus compatibility for newer Harley models, the challenges associated with LED adoption are progressively being addressed, solidifying their position as the superior lighting solution for these iconic machines.

Understanding Harley-Davidson Lighting Technologies

Harley-Davidson motorcycles have a rich history, and their lighting systems have evolved alongside them. Traditionally, Harley Davidsons utilized incandescent bulbs, which, while reliable, have inherent limitations in terms of brightness, lifespan, and energy efficiency. These older halogen bulbs generate light by heating a filament until it glows, a process that is inherently inefficient and produces a significant amount of heat. This heat can contribute to premature bulb failure and, in some cases, affect surrounding components. Furthermore, the light output from incandescent bulbs tends to be yellowish and less focused than modern LED alternatives, impacting visibility in diverse riding conditions. Understanding these fundamental differences is crucial for appreciating the advantages LED technology brings to your Harley.

The shift towards LED (Light Emitting Diode) technology represents a significant upgrade for any Harley-Davidson owner. LEDs are semiconductor devices that emit light when an electric current passes through them. This process is far more efficient than incandescent bulbs, converting a greater proportion of electrical energy into light rather than heat. This efficiency translates to a lower draw on the motorcycle’s electrical system, freeing up power for other accessories. Moreover, LEDs are known for their exceptional lifespan, often lasting tens of thousands of hours longer than traditional bulbs. This means fewer replacements, reduced maintenance, and a more consistent and reliable lighting performance over the life of your motorcycle.

Installation and Compatibility Considerations

Proper installation is crucial to ensure your new LED lights function correctly and safely on your Harley-Davidson. While many aftermarket LED kits are designed for plug-and-play installation, meaning they directly replace the original bulbs or assemblies, some may require minor modifications or the use of adapter harnesses. It’s essential to consult the product’s installation manual and, if you’re not comfortable with electrical work, to seek professional installation from a qualified motorcycle mechanic. Incorrect wiring or improper fitting can lead to electrical issues, premature failure of the LEDs, or even compromise safety.

Compatibility with your specific Harley-Davidson model and year is a non-negotiable factor. Different Harley models have distinct headlight housings, taillight designs, and electrical systems. A universal LED bulb might fit into a socket, but it won’t necessarily produce the correct beam pattern or have the proper electrical connections. Look for LED kits explicitly advertised as compatible with your motorcycle’s make, model, and year. This ensures that the physical dimensions will fit the existing mounts, the electrical connectors will mate correctly, and the beam pattern will be optimized for your headlight housing.

The CAN bus (Controller Area Network) system found in many modern Harley-Davidson motorcycles can also present compatibility challenges with some LED lighting systems. The CAN bus system monitors various electrical components, and a sudden change in electrical resistance or load from an incompatible LED can trigger error codes or dashboard warning lights. Many reputable LED manufacturers design their products with built-in resistors or decoders to prevent these CAN bus errors. Always verify that the LED lights you choose are CAN bus compatible for your specific Harley model to avoid these frustrating issues.

When assessing compatibility, also consider any regulatory requirements in your region regarding automotive lighting. Ensure that the LED lights you select meet local standards for brightness, color, and beam pattern, particularly for headlights. While many aftermarket LEDs offer superior performance, they must also comply with legal stipulations to ensure road legality and avoid potential fines or inspections. Researching these aspects beforehand will save you time and potential headaches down the line.

Color Temperature and Visual Clarity

Color temperature, measured in Kelvin (K), describes the hue of the light emitted. Halogen bulbs typically produce a warm, yellowish light with a color temperature around 2700K-3000K. LED lights, on the other hand, can be engineered to produce a cooler, whiter light, often ranging from 4000K to 6000K. This whiter light closely mimics natural daylight, which is generally perceived as being more comfortable for the eyes and can improve visual acuity. The increased color rendering index (CRI) of many LED lights also plays a crucial role. CRI measures how accurately a light source reveals the true colors of objects. A higher CRI means colors appear more vibrant and distinct under the light, making it easier to distinguish road markings, signs, and other details. For Harley Davidson riders, opting for LED lights with a color temperature around 5000K-6000K can provide a crisper, cleaner illumination that enhances peripheral vision and overall road awareness.

The practical benefits of a cooler color temperature and higher CRI are substantial for rider safety and comfort. The whiter light reduces eye strain during prolonged rides, especially at night, as it requires less effort for the brain to process compared to the yellowish hue of halogen bulbs. This improved visual clarity can lead to reduced fatigue and increased focus. Furthermore, the enhanced color rendering of objects under LED light makes it easier to differentiate between various road surfaces, identifying potential hazards like oil slicks or debris more readily. For instance, a clear white LED brake light can make the red of the brake light stand out more prominently against the background, ensuring it’s seen more clearly by other drivers. When considering the best LED lights for Harley Davidson, pay close attention to the Kelvin rating and look for products that advertise a high CRI for optimal visual performance.

Power Efficiency and Electrical System Impact

A significant advantage of LED lighting for Harley-Davidson motorcycles is its exceptional power efficiency. LEDs consume substantially less power than incandescent bulbs while producing equivalent or superior light output. For instance, an LED headlight that outputs 2,000 lumens might consume as little as 25-30 watts, whereas a halogen headlight producing 1,000 lumens could consume 55 watts or more. This reduction in power draw is particularly beneficial for older Harley models that may have less robust electrical systems or for riders who utilize numerous auxiliary electrical accessories like heated grips, sound systems, or extra lighting. By reducing the load on the motorcycle’s charging system (alternator and battery), LEDs can contribute to a more stable electrical supply, potentially extending the life of these components and preventing battery drain.

The practical implications of this power efficiency are far-reaching. Riders can confidently run their headlights, taillights, and potentially additional LED accessories without worrying about overloading the electrical system or significantly depleting the battery. This is especially important during low-speed riding or extended idling where the alternator is not operating at its peak capacity. Moreover, some advanced LED systems even offer variable voltage input, allowing them to operate efficiently across a range of voltage fluctuations common in motorcycle electrical systems. When selecting the best LED lights for Harley Davidson, pay attention to the wattage consumption per light. Manufacturers that provide clear wattage specifications allow riders to accurately assess the impact on their motorcycle’s electrical system and plan their accessory usage accordingly.

What is the typical lifespan of an LED headlight for a Harley Davidson compared to a halogen bulb?

The lifespan of an LED headlight for a Harley Davidson significantly surpasses that of a traditional halogen bulb, contributing to long-term cost savings and convenience. While a standard halogen headlight bulb typically lasts between 500 to 1,000 hours of use, LED headlights, when properly manufactured and installed, can endure anywhere from 30,000 to 50,000 hours or even more. This difference is due to the fundamental technology: halogen bulbs produce light by heating a filament until it glows, a process that inevitably degrades the filament over time.

LEDs, on the other hand, generate light through the movement of electrons in a semiconductor material, a process that is inherently more durable and efficient. The extended lifespan of LEDs means that you are unlikely to need to replace them for the entire ownership period of your motorcycle, eliminating the recurring expense and hassle of purchasing and fitting new bulbs. This longevity is a key selling point for LED technology in automotive applications, including for Harley Davidson riders who value reliability and reduced maintenance.
